Account for Volkswagen Group's 2026 third-party API lockout when planning a We Connect / CarNet integration for VW, Audi, Škoda, or Cupra

Steps
Confirm current status before building anything: as of May 2026, Volkswagen Group disabled the authentication flow that let third-party apps read/control vehicles using stored owner credentials alone, across VW, Audi, Škoda, and Cupra
Check whether the specific brand/market you need has a legitimate high-mobility.com or OEM-published data API alternative instead of the retired consumer-credential flow
If pursuing official access, expect to establish a formal business-to-business relationship with Volkswagen Group Info Services, including app attestation, rather than a simple API-key signup
If relying on a community library, verify it has migrated to the new attestation-based flow (e.g., successor projects to WeConnect-python) rather than assuming an older library still works
Document this dependency risk explicitly for stakeholders, since VW Group has shown it will change or remove third-party access with little advance notice
Known gotchas
Any integration guide describing simple username/password login against We Connect/CarNet predates the May 2026 change and will no longer authenticate — this is a live, breaking change, not a hypothetical risk
The replacement token flow requires cryptographic attestation tying requests to an officially registered VW Group app, which locks out DIY/community clients that can't obtain that attestation
Because the shutdown spans multiple brands (VW, Audi, Škoda, Cupra) under one Info Services layer, a workaround found for one brand's endpoint may not generalize to the others
